One thing to consider is pairing Helena with a more readable font for body copy. In this case, I used a clean serif font for the instructions and ingredients, ensuring that the handwritten style remained a decorative element rather than a distraction. This balance is essential when working with expressive fonts like Helena.

Before using Helena in commercial projects, it’s important to review the included styles, ligatures, and licensing options. Ensuring that the font supports the intended use—whether it’s for an ebook, template, or paid download—is essential for avoiding any legal or technical issues down the line.
